In recent years, artificial intelligence (AI) has revolutionized many fields, including sports. One of the most promising developments is AI-powered video analysis, which helps athletes and coaches improve technique and performance through detailed insights.
What is AI-Powered Video Analysis?
AI-powered video analysis uses machine learning algorithms to examine footage of athletes during training or competition. These systems can identify key movements, measure angles, and detect errors that might be missed by the human eye.
Key Components of Developing AI Video Analysis Tools
- Data Collection: Gathering high-quality videos of athletes performing various techniques.
- Annotation: Labeling video data to teach the AI what correct and incorrect movements look like.
- Model Training: Using machine learning algorithms to learn patterns and identify key features.
- Analysis and Feedback: Providing real-time or post-session insights to athletes and coaches.
Applications in Sports Training
AI-driven video analysis can be applied across many sports, including:
- Golf: Improving swing mechanics
- Basketball: Analyzing shooting form
- Soccer: Enhancing kicking techniques
- Swimming: Refining stroke efficiency
Challenges and Future Directions
While AI video analysis offers many benefits, challenges remain. These include the need for large, diverse datasets and ensuring the AI can adapt to different body types and styles. Future advancements may include more personalized feedback and integration with wearable sensors for comprehensive analysis.
